A podcast where people get to learn more about public health work in Africa and how to navigate their public health careers. Each episode features an in depth interview with a public health practitioner and/or researcher from an African country and/or working in African countries in public health. Conversation is about how they ended up working in public health, what they do at a high level in their current work, what they love about their field and career path and what words of wisdom they would like to share with the audience.

Episode 6-Interview with Dorcas Kareithi
In this episode with Dorcas Kareithi a clinical trials statistician from Kenya currently based in the UK we discussed: Dorcas’s  background and how her love for Math led her to study Applied Statistics What she calls herself  Dorcas’s love for data, data  puns and t shirts with them All the key steps she took to end up working in health with her skillset Difference between being a researcher and statistician  What influenced her interest in health from family to books she read growing up  How she ended up working in health after her Bachelor's degree  and key steps she took to lead herself there Mentorship and the role it has played in her career Different types of mentors Highlights from her current and previous work What is her favorite thing about her work and working in public health  What she likes the least about working in public health  Ethics in public health research Inequalities in healthcare access The importance of government buy in and will to bridge research findings to policy and implementation  Importance of documenting failures in research  Her top 3 software recommendations Words of wisdom especially to people looking to have careers in statistics  Her resource plugs: Young African Statisticians (YASA): https://twitter.com/africanyas Words that count:  https://twitter.com/wordsafrica RLadies Nairobi: https://twitter.com/rladiesnairobi
